Lines Matching refs:virt

121 extern u_long mac_drv_virt2phys(struct s_smc *smc, void *virt);
122 extern u_long dma_master(struct s_smc *smc, void *virt, int len, int flag);
147 void hwm_tx_frag(struct s_smc *smc, char far *virt, u_long phys, int len,
149 void hwm_rx_frag(struct s_smc *smc, char far *virt, u_long phys, int len,
1053 u_char far *virt ; in process_receive() local
1225 virt = (u_char far *) rxd->rxd_virt ; in process_receive()
1226 DB_RX("FC = %x",*virt,0,2) ; in process_receive()
1227 if (virt[12] == MA[5] && in process_receive()
1228 virt[11] == MA[4] && in process_receive()
1229 virt[10] == MA[3] && in process_receive()
1230 virt[9] == MA[2] && in process_receive()
1231 virt[8] == MA[1] && in process_receive()
1232 (virt[7] & ~GROUP_ADDR_BIT) == MA[0]) { in process_receive()
1246 if(!(virt[1] & GROUP_ADDR_BIT)) { in process_receive()
1247 if (virt[6] != MA[5] || in process_receive()
1248 virt[5] != MA[4] || in process_receive()
1249 virt[4] != MA[3] || in process_receive()
1250 virt[3] != MA[2] || in process_receive()
1251 virt[2] != MA[1] || in process_receive()
1252 virt[1] != MA[0]) { in process_receive()
1415 void hwm_rx_frag(struct s_smc *smc, char far *virt, u_long phys, int len, in hwm_rx_frag() argument
1421 NDD_TRACE("RHfB",virt,len,frame_status) ; in hwm_rx_frag()
1424 r->rxd_virt = virt ; in hwm_rx_frag()
1628 void hwm_tx_frag(struct s_smc *smc, char far *virt, u_long phys, int len, in hwm_tx_frag() argument
1637 NDD_TRACE("THfB",virt,len,frame_status) ; in hwm_tx_frag()
1648 DB_TX("LAN_TX: TxD = %x, virt = %x ",t,virt,3) ; in hwm_tx_frag()
1649 t->txd_virt = virt ; in hwm_tx_frag()
1697 memcpy(smc->os.hwm.tx_data,virt,len) ; in hwm_tx_frag()
1814 SK_LOC_DECL(char far,*virt[3]) ; in smt_send_mbuf()
1842 virt[frag_count] = data ; in smt_send_mbuf()
1890 t->txd_virt = virt[i] ; in smt_send_mbuf()
1891 phys = dma_master(smc, (void far *)virt[i], in smt_send_mbuf()